People Score in 11946, Hampton Bays, New York

The People Score for the Overall Health Score in 11946, Hampton Bays, New York is 47 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.

An estimate of 87.66 percent of the residents in 11946 has some form of health insurance. 31.99 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 71.12 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.

A resident in 11946 would have to travel an average of 8.01 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Peconic Bay Medical Center. In a 20-mile radius, there are 3,893 healthcare providers accessible to residents living in 11946, Hampton Bays, New York.

**The Housing Equation: Where You Live Matters**

The **places to live** in Hampton Bays also play a role in the overall health score. Access to safe, affordable housing is a fundamental determinant of health.

Consider the impact of housing affordability on stress levels. When people struggle to afford their housing, they experience increased stress, which can negatively impact their physical and mental health.

The availability of well-maintained housing also plays a role. Poor housing conditions, such as mold, lead paint, and inadequate heating or cooling, can contribute to respiratory problems, allergies, and other health issues.

The location of housing is also important. Proximity to grocery stores, healthcare facilities, and recreational opportunities can significantly impact a person's health and well-being.
